Henkel AQUENCE LP3391LV Hot Melt Adhesive

Henkel AQUENCE LP3391LV is a low-viscosity, high-performance hot melt adhesive designed for high-speed packaging and assembly. Part of Henkel’s AQUENCE series, it offers excellent heat resistance, strong initial tack, and consistent bond durability on diverse substrates including coated board and plastics—ideal for demanding industrial applications requiring precision and reliability.

Features Of Henkel AQUENCE LP3391LV Hot Melt Adhesive

  1. Low-viscosity formulation enables high-speed roll-to-roll processing and excellent substrate wetting on porous and non-porous surfaces.

  2. Optimized for low-temperature application (120–140 °C), reducing energy consumption and minimizing thermal stress on heat-sensitive substrates.

  3. Excellent open time and bond strength development at ambient conditions, supporting efficient downstream handling.

  4. REACH-compliant and formulated without added bisphenol A (BPA), phthalates, or heavy metals.

  5. Consistent rheological performance across batch production, ensuring process stability in industrial adhesive dispensing systems.

Typical Applications Of Henkel AQUENCE LP3391LV Hot Melt Adhesive

  1. Nonwoven lamination in hygiene products (e.g., diaper leg cuffs, backsheet bonding).

  2. Medical device assembly, including breathable barrier laminates and wearable sensor mounting.

  3. Lightweight packaging assembly for paper-based flexible pouches and sustainable mono-material structures.

  4. Automotive interior trim bonding, such as headliner fabrics, carpet underlay, and acoustic insulation layers.

  5. Electronics component taping and protective film anchoring in cleanroom-compatible manufacturing environments.

Specifications Of Henkel AQUENCE LP3391LV Hot Melt Adhesive

Chemical TypeStyrene–isoprene–styrene (SIS) thermoplastic elastomer base
Product FormPellets
AppearanceLight amber, semi-crystalline pellets
Softening Point (Ring & Ball, °C)78–82
Melt Viscosity (cP at 130 °C, Brookfield RV)3,200–3,800
Service Temperature Range–20 °C to +60 °C (continuous)
Primary ApplicationsLamination of nonwovens, films, and papers in high-speed converting
Key FeaturesLow-temperature applicability, low odor, good peel adhesion to polyolefins and cellulose substrates
